Abstract
Subdural empyema (SDE) is an extremely rare but serious complication of dental infection. A case is presented in which dental infection was complicated by a masticator space abscess and eventually led to a SDE. This report illustrates a rare sequence of events leading to SDE and its serendipitous detection by indium-111-labeled leucocyte scan.
